Nvidia: Lenovo's servers are its good brothers

As Nvidia provides data transmission speed channels, device modules for training and inference in AI technology, it has attracted much attention and become the focus company of this round of AI technology, as well as the main driver of the recent surge in US stocks.

Jensen Huang said, "Speed is sustainability, speed is performance, speed is energy efficiency."

When performance doubles or triples at a rate - 'to know this is the annual growth - we can effectively reduce the cost, workload, and energy consumption of AI, while also enhancing the revenue-generating capabilities of AI.' Huang Renxun believes, 'Unlike all data centers storing files, these data centers are AI factories that produce tokens. You would want the tokens to be produced at the highest possible speed - these tokens are actually artificial intelligence - you would want them to be produced as fast as possible.'

For a key AI technology company like this, it is very clear about Lenovo Group's position in its entire AI technology system, hence the two companies' technical cooperation is becoming increasingly close.

The result of the cooperation between these two companies this year is the launch of the new generation AI server Think System SC777 by Lenovo Group. This server adopts Lenovo's sixth-generation Neptune liquid cooling system technology, integrates NVIDIA Grace Blackwell GB200 AI acceleration card, uses 100% water-cooling design, and does not require any fans or dedicated data center air conditioning.

Huang Renxun commented on this, 'The efforts Lenovo has put into building high-performance computers over the years have paid off.'

In fact, from the perspective of importance, Think System SC777 is just an appetizer. The truly important technological collaboration between the two parties is the joint launch of the 'Lenovo Hybrid AI Advantage Set.'

This is an end-to-end AI platform for developing and deploying AI in the new era: based on technologically superior infrastructure, including AI equipment, AI servers, storage, as well as edge computing, public and private clouds, becoming the carrier for enterprises to store, clean, and organize data.

The framework of the Lenovo Hybrid AI Advantage Set includes the new Lenovo AI Library, which is a comprehensive repository of AI templates, allowing enterprises to implement AI solutions with minimal complexity, covering multiple industries and business functions, including marketing, IT operations, product development, and customer service.

Data algorithms and accelerated computing power collectively drive enterprise AI implementation, optimizing processes, making better decisions, and increasing productivity.

Among all these elements, services play an important role - managing the full lifecycle of infrastructure including design, deployment, expansion, and maintenance, enhancing data analysis and governance capabilities, providing consultation and optimization for ai models, and expanding the ai software ecosystem for customers.

Building on the concept of a hybrid ai factory, Lenovo also offers the Lenovo ai app library. Wall Street understands that Lenovo Group's strategic approach to the 'hybrid ai advantage set' combines modular and customized elements to quickly respond to customer needs and tailor solutions for them.

All these areas together form the complete system of the 'hybrid ai advantage set' resulting from the collaboration between Lenovo and Nvidia.

At the 2023 Lenovo Tech World Conference, Lenovo Group and Nvidia announced an expanded partnership. Through the collaboration of the two companies in full-stack ai product portfolios, Lenovo Group and Nvidia's hybrid ai advantage set will be realized, bringing ai-driven computing rapidly and conveniently to anywhere.

Driving unprecedented cooperation between archenemies.

Lenovo possesses a unique advantage in providing a diverse hybrid ai ecosystem, covering the widest range of products in the market - from personal computers, smart phones, mixed reality (MR), tablets, device accessories to servers, storage, and public/private clouds.

When it comes to personal computers, the CEOs of Intel and AMD also attended the Lenovo Tech World 2024 Conference and made a rare joint statement affirming that they will shake hands and establish a new x86 Ecosystem Advisory Group to reshape the future of x86.

Kissinger described this collaboration with AMD as 'unprecedented, a first-time partnership.'

It is worth noting that Lenovo Group is also the founding company of this consulting group. Although not officially confirmed by Lenovo Group, with the personal presence of Henry Kissinger and Su Zifeng, jointly announcing the cooperation, it is not difficult to imagine that Lenovo is likely the backstage driver of this collaboration.

In addition to Lenovo, Intel, and AMD, the members of the x86 Ecosystem Consulting Group also include Tim Sweeney, Broadcom, VMware, Google, Microsoft, Oracle, and Red Hat.

In the AI section of personal computers, Lenovo Group has launched the world's first personal AI smart agent aimed at the global market - Lenovo AI Now. This is a personal AI smart agent embedded in PCs.

Yang Yuanqing described what a personal AI smart agent is: using natural interaction to understand user intent, extracting relevant information from the user's personal knowledge base on the device, breaking down tasks, providing answers, and devising execution plans.

"More importantly, it is connected to an open ecosystem, supported by heterogeneous computing, and ensures privacy and data security." Yang Yuanqing said, "Ultimately, it will become your personal artificial intelligence twin."

Kissinger believes, "AI devices are fundamentally changing the cost economics of artificial intelligence. I don't need to go somewhere to use AI, it's on my device (AI PC). I don't need to store my valuable data in some cloud, it's on my device. I don't need network costs, it's on my device."

In order to make AI accessible, PC devices must be equipped with a heterogeneous computing chip, a combination of CPU, GPU, and NPU, also known as "XPU."

Lenovo Group has chosen Intel and AMD to provide this chip.

The collaboration with Intel is Lenovo's launch of the Aura Edition personal computer - a series of high-end AI-enhanced laptops jointly developed by both parties, released by Lenovo at IFA 2024.

Aura Edition features 3 exclusive key functions: the main one being Smart Share for intelligent sharing.

Users only need to connect their smart phone to the computer to instantly share and edit without switching between different ecosystems or complex steps. This series of laptops also feature Smart Modes and Smart Care, adapting to various usage scenarios, guiding users in self-diagnosis, and providing real-time agent support.

If it wasn't for Kissinger's exaggeration, then the Aura Edition is definitely not the assembly product of the past.

"Aura Edition is not only our joint innovation, but also our joint concept." Kissinger said, "Can the x86 architecture have outstanding battery life? Now, this debate is over. Aura Edition is equipped with Core Ultra, with outstanding performance and incredible battery life."

Kissinger admits that the Aura Edition with Lenovo's AI Now built-in is defined jointly by Intel and the Lenovo Group.

In fact, the collaboration between AMD and Lenovo seems more comprehensive and in-depth compared to Lenovo's collaboration with Intel only on personal PCs. Su Zifeng said, "Through our collaboration with Lenovo, we have truly built a comprehensive solution from ThinkPad (AI PC), to ThinkSystem (AI servers), to ThinkStation (AI workstations, divided into C, S, and P series)."

For example, one of the collaboration results just released by AMD and Lenovo: the joint launch of the 5th generation of AMD EPYC™ processors. These are CPUs specifically designed for cloud computing, enterprise applications, and artificial intelligence, mainly used in data centers.

Su Zifeng believes that AMD's mission is to provide computing power for generative AI – a direction that Su Zifeng's relative, Huang Renxun, is also working hard towards.

According to Su Zifeng, AMD's latest released Instinct MI325X AI accelerator card will be shipped at the end of the fourth quarter of 2024, and will supply Lenovo Group in the first quarter of 2025.

What is open? WoA, which can be both an enemy and a friend.

Intel and Lenovo Group are strategic deep cooperation partners, hence they can jointly define important AI PC products – it is worth mentioning that some AI PC products launched by Lenovo are equipped with the Qualcomm Snapdragon X Elite CPU (based on ARM architecture) – but Lenovo's open ecosystem also includes more partner companies, such as Microsoft.

Yang Yuanqing said, "We are collaborating with Microsoft to develop Copilot+PC to add more artificial intelligence features to Lenovo's AI PC. These features include real-time audio translation with Live Captions, as well as Windows Studio Effects that automatically improve brightness and eliminate noise during video calls."

Wall Street News noted that Qualcomm's CEO An Mong sent a congratulatory video, not personally present. Indeed, the x86 ecosystem advisory group formed by Lenovo, Intel, and AMD might make Qualcomm feel awkward.

Microsoft may also feel awkward, even though Lenovo Tech World 2024 was held in Microsoft's hometown of Seattle, Microsoft's CEO Satya Nadella did not attend in person, like Qualcomm's An Mong, participating via video.

Microsoft's embarrassment may stem from "betraying" its long-term partner, Intel, who jointly built the longest-running tech alliance in the industry – Wintel's core member – as Microsoft surprisingly partnered with Qualcomm to introduce the Windows on Arm (WoA) system to explore the AI PC market.

Qualcomm has entered the field of AI PCs with CPUs based on the ARM architecture. Its processors based on the ARM architecture have already caught up with x86 in terms of performance, with low power consumption being a core technology point of the ARM architecture.

Of course, there are intricate and complex interests among modern technology giants. Although Qualcomm and Microsoft belong to the ARM camp, Lenovo's ecosystem is open, hence Microsoft and Qualcomm remain members of Lenovo's global ecosystem partners.

Satya Nadella said, 'We are collaborating to integrate the content security features of Azure AI into Lenovo's personal AI intelligent system to help detect and intercept potential risks, threats, and quality issues. We are also excited about the progress of the Copilot+ PCs project, including the brand-new AI experience just released this month.'

Without being present on the scene, Wall Street See would not have fully understood the extent of the cooperation between Lenovo Group and Meta company.

According to Yang Yuanqing, Meta is a 'super important' partner of Lenovo Group in the fields of spatial computing, artificial intelligence, and mixed reality.

Lenovo has just launched AI Now. Mark Zuckerberg revealed that AI Now is built on Meta's Llama model, thus 'truly transforming the PC into a more practical and personalized intelligent device. This is also why we have open-sourced Llama, so that companies like Lenovo can fine-tune large language models to optimize their performance in specific usage scenarios.'

Open source is currently the most cost-effective, customizable, reliable, and performance-optimized choice.

Zuckerberg announced that Lenovo's PCs are compatible with Meta's first consumer-grade VR device, Oculus Rift, 'We have collaborated to build its next-generation product Oculus Rift S.'

In addition, Lenovo also plans to launch a mixed reality headset with Meta Horizon OS, which will also be used in Meta's Meta Quest headset.

The collaboration between Meta and Lenovo is not limited to the hardware level, but also includes software: In addition to planning to launch the Lenovo MR headset with Meta Horizon OS, the two sides have jointly developed a 2D application.

This application will soon be available on the Meta Horizon store, allowing users to use Motorola phones in Quest without removing the headset. This means that users can interact with any application on their phone in a larger virtual screen.
